Welcome aboard on-call for Ovenreach. One rule you must internalize early: the order-cutoff job. Every storefront accepts next-day orders until 17:30 local time, after which the cutoff worker freezes the order book and hands totals to the prep-planning service. If the worker stalls, bakeries receive no prep sheet and morning production slips, so any cutoff alert is treated as high priority regardless of hour. Escalation steps, restart commands, and known failure signatures are collected on the internal page below.

dashboard of tahop-fahof = https://harbor.tolvaqnet.example/secrets/merge_requests/board/issue/merge_requests/pipeline/secrets/ecb30ed86a55c001a77f6cb9

Subject: Handover — Brindlewick health checks

Hi Marek,

Taking over the Brindlewick release this week. The load balancer now probes /healthz on port 8443 every ten seconds; two consecutive failures pull a node from rotation. Staging confirmed the new drain behavior works during rolling deploys. Nothing else changed since the dry run Tuesday. Artifacts for 4.2.1 are staged and verified against the deploy key below.

signing key of kagaf-kawif = bky9_TUKEcBvKn

## Ownership

The Brindlewood consent banner rollout is gated by region and proceeds in three waves, each requiring a signed-off legal text bundle before the feature flag advances. Release managers must confirm the translations manifest hash matches the approved bundle and that opt-out telemetry is flowing before promoting a wave. Rollbacks revert both the flag and the text bundle together. Final authority for wave promotions and emergency rollbacks belongs to the owner named below.

named custodian: Brivan Eliath Quenox Frador

## Deploying the Gatewick Proctor Queue

Deploys are pretty painless: push to main, wait for the pipeline, then watch the queue drain dashboard for five minutes. If candidates pile up mid-exam, roll back first and ask questions later — the queue replays safely. Everything the workers care about lives in one config block, shown here for reference.

settings of bafof-yagef:
JOROX_PIN=8740
JOROX_TENANT=pelox
JOROX_METRICS_HOST=metrics.jorox.qorvelworks.internal
JOROX_SEAL=seal_c78f63c1
JOROX_STANDBY_TEAM=norax